About this property
Duck - Sound View, w/ Pool, Hot Tub, Kayaks, Bikes, Billiards & Guest Pantry
We love our beach cottage and know you will, too. "Sounds Good" is a custom-built 3,320 sq. ft. three-level home loaded with great amenities. Our cottage has three master suites because privacy matters, a private pool and hot tub, and a well-equipped kitchen with a fully stocked guest pantry. There is a sports lounge on the ground level with a wet bar, billiards, and a large flat-screen TV for watching your favorite movies or for quality gaming. Call us crazy, but we still have cable TV throughout the cottage, and the main TVs also stream. Sounds Good is our second home, and we visit it often, so we only open our cottage to guests for a very short season, simply because we miss it too much when we're gone.
One important note: though Sounds Good is in Duck, we are passionate about the wild Banker horses in Corolla, just 8 miles north. When you stay with us, $50 from your week's rental is gladly donated to the Corolla Wild Horse Fund to help these wild horses continue to thrive. Okay, back to cottage info...
Our five-bedroom, five and 1/2-bath home is super clean. We are committed to keeping this level of quality for our guests (and ourselves). We aim to exceed your expectations because your vacation and investment are important. At the same time, we INSIST that our guests are respectful and gentle on our home.
Sounds Good is a peaceful, laid-back place to vacation. We do not host parties and will not tolerate rowdy behavior; that's just not what we are about. We are about- is being readily available to you before and during your stay. We enjoy getting to know our guests and respond quickly to any need or question about the cottage or visiting the Outer Banks. Consider us your text-able concierge! We offer a well-stocked guest pantry; please see the photo in our gallery. Please bring your own linens and towels, or they can be easily rented from a company right down the street and conveniently delivered to the cottage.
Sounds Good is in one of Duck's most charming communities, Carolina Dunes, and is near the ocean, only one walkable block to the beach access, and the Currituck sound is just 50 yards away from the front door. Enjoy the Currituck sound and sunset views from the front balcony.
You'll be near all the things that make for a perfect family vacation: whether it's strolling along the Currituck sound walking trail, directly in front of the cottage, or wandering through the sound front shops (1.8 miles south - a walk or bike ride away), or dining at one of the many nearby restaurants, or visiting the Duck town park for an evening concert, you won't have to travel far or necessarily by car.
Back at the cottage, relax on one of the spacious decks or enjoy a good book under the second-floor covered deck, or chill in the hammock swing. The fenced backyard offers mature live oaks and is extremely private. Cool off in the backyard pool or go kayaking using our two kayaks. Launching the kayaks from the community dock is just a block and a half south. We've got the gear: wheel dollies, paddles, and life vests.
Game night is always fun, and our home has plenty of board game choices. Downstairs, the sports lounge has two TVs, one at the wet bar and the main flat-screen TV. There's an apartment-size dishwasher, microwave, full-size stainless refrigerator, and a high-quality 9' pool table.
If you're looking for location, fun, relaxation, and comfort, Sounds Good has it all because it's not a busy rental; it's our home!
House Gear: Four beach bikes, six beach chairs, various floats, two beach umbrellas, DVDs, books, a high-chair, crib, booster chair, changing table, pack n' play, all expected deck furniture, hammock swing, gas grill, Blackstone griddle, and beach buggy to cart your gear to the beach, which is only a 5-minute walk.
